Condition:Used Brand:GMC Placement on Vehicle:Right, Front

This fender came of a 1946 GMC. This will fit both Chevy and GMC 1.5 and 2 ton trucks. This fender will bolt to the smaller trucks but will not look correct because the fender is cut higher to accommodate the 20" wheels. Steel is solid with no rust through however there are plenty of rips, dents and a few holes.  This fender will ship Greyhound shipping.  This means the buyer will NOT have the item shipped to their home. New 1.0-litre turbo for Vauxhall Adam

Sun, 18 Aug 2013

A frugal new 1.0-litre SIDI three-cylinder turbo petrol engine will go on sale in the Vauxhall Adam city car in 2014, following its debut at next month’s 2013 Frankfurt Motor Show. The new low-emissions unit – a rival to Ford’s 1.0 Ecoboost engine in the Fiesta and Focus – will deliver “impressive fuel economy and CO2 emissions significantly lower than 100g/km”, according to Vauxhall. Lambo Superleggera (2010) at Geneva motor show

Mon, 01 Mar 2010

This beautiful green beast is the new Lamborghini Gallardo LP570-4 Superleggera, unveiled tonight at the Volkswagen Group’s big party ahead of tomorrow’s 2010 Geneva motor show.  This LP570-4 Superleggera will hit 62mph in 3.4 seconds (its predecessor took four tenths longer and the LP560-4 needs 3.7 seconds for the benchmark sprint), dash past 124mph after 10.2 seconds, and reach 202mph flat out. It’s not a harder, faster version of the special edition, rear-drive Balboni Gallardo, but a harder, faster version of the regular LP560-4. Spot on.

Volvo Estate Concept (2014) first official pictures

Thu, 27 Feb 2014

By Ollie Kew First Official Pictures 27 February 2014 11:00 This is the Volvo Concept Estate, which will be shown at the 2014 Geneva motor show. It’s a true three-door shooting brake wagon: Volvo claims it points strongly toward the future design of its V70 and XC70 estate models. Rather than going down the swooping roofline/thick pillars route for his shooting brake design, Volvo’s new design boss Thomas Ingenlath was inspired by the P1800 ES of the 1970s.
